Abstract
The aim of the invention - a reliable, efficient, installable and dismountable wind, water sway, waves and underwater currents power plant, which converts wind and water sway, waves and underwater currents flow kinetic energy into electrical energy.In this power plant, which operates as a single unit, are connected several power plants: wind turbine and the water (especially sea or ocean) sway, waves and underwater currents power plant. Water sway, waves and underwater currents power plant is based on a very efficient hydraulic pumps and special cables, which provides extremely high water kinetic energy flow conversion into kinetic energy of electricity.
